How the model works. Layoff path: replacement cost (salary × replacement %) plus the ramp-up dip (salary × dip % × 4/12 months) for every affected employee. Redeploy path: the internal move cost for everyone who lands in a spot, and the full layoff cost for anyone who does not — because not every unit has enough open postings. The calculator caps spots at headcount and never hides the people who would still be let go. Replace the assumptions with your own benchmarks before presenting the number.
